There are numerous types of cat doors in the market. Understanding professional pet door installers assists you select one that matches your requirements and your cat’s behavior.
1. Requirement Cat Doors
These are standard cat doors, generally simple flaps that swing both methods. They are cost-efficient and perfect for homes with flat surfaces.
2. Lockable Cat Doors
These doors permit you to secure your cat indoors or outdoors. Lockable options offer you greater control over your pet’s motions.
3. Microchip Cat Doors
High-tech services, these doors only open for your cat, recognized by their microchip. This prevents other family pets from getting in, making it an exceptional choice for multi-pet homes.
4. Electromagnetic Cat Doors
Electro-magnetic doors deal with a collar tag worn by your cat, permitting entry while leaving out other animals. These are a solid alternative for guaranteeing your home is pet-proof.
5. Vertical Cat Doors
Perfect for little spaces, these doors move up and down rather than swinging open, making them a good fit in compact locations.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: How much does it cost to hire a cat door fitter?
The cost of employing a cat door fitter varies depending upon aspects such as area, type of door, and any additional services needed. Typically, installation charges can vary from ₤ 75 to ₤ 250.
Q2: Can I install a cat door in a wall or simply in a door?
Yes, cat doors can be installed in both doors and walls. However, wall installations require extra reinforcement, which experts can manage.
Q3: How do I train my cat to use a new cat door?
Training your cat usually involves perseverance and encouragement. You can hold the door open and carefully guide your cat through while providing treats as positive support.
Q4: What if my cat declines to use the door?
If your cat is reluctant, ensure the door opens quickly and is at a comfy height. Slowly coax them with treats, and don’t hurry the procedure.
Q5: Are there any safety concerns with cat doors?
While cat doors increase liberty for your pet, they can likewise allow dangers such as unwanted wildlife entering your home. Consider options like microchip or lockable doors for added security.
Q6: How long does the installation take?
Many cat door installations take between one to two hours, depending upon the complexity of the door choice and location.
